Peak oxygen uptake impairment in childhood cancer survivors treated with anthracycline-based chemotherapy: a systematic-review and meta-analysis

Abstract Background Exposure to cardiotoxic therapies such as anthracycline chemotherapy places childhood cancer survivors (CCS) at markedly increased risk of heart failure and cardiovascular mortality. Peak oxygen uptake (VO2peak) is an objective marker of cardiovascular function that is a strong predictor of incident heart failure and cardiovascular mortality. However, the degree of VO2peak impairment in CCS is yet to be definitively established. Purpose To perform a systematic review and meta-analysis comparing VO2peak and cardiac function in CCS treated with anthracycline chemotherapy versus age-matched non-cancer controls (CON). Methods A systematic search was performed using Embase, Scopus, MEDLINE, CINAHL and SPORTDiscus databases to identify cross-sectional studies comparing VO2peak (primary outcome) and resting cardiac function in CCS versus CON. Studies were included if i) participants were childhood cancer survivors (≤18 years old when cancer was diagnosed) exposed to anthracycline-based chemotherapy; ii) assessments were performed after completing adjuvant therapy; iii) reported VO2peak assessed from a maximal exercise test with expired gas analysis. Studies were excluded if they i) reported no original data; ii) did not include a healthy non-cancer control group; iii) reported duplicate data; iv) were not available in English. Values for CCS and CON were compared using a fixed-effects model, with results reported as weighted mean differences (WMD) with 95% confidence interval (95% CI) for the difference between CCS relative to CON. Heterogeneity was determined using the I2 statistic. Results 2026 studies were identified, of which 18 unique case-control studies reporting peak VO2 in CCS (n=786, 44% female, mean age: 16 yrs, mean time post-therapy: 2.7 yrs) and CON (n=1379, 50% female, mean age: 16 yrs) were included in the meta-analysis. Childhood cancer survivors had markedly lower VO2peak (WMD: -7.08 mL/kg/min; 95% CI: -7.75 to -6.42, I2: 79%). Resting left-ventricular ejection fraction (LVEF) was the only measure of cardiac function with a sufficient number of studies for meta-analysis (n=5 studies). In contrast to VO2peak, there was only a small decrement in resting LVEF (WMD: -1.6%; 95% CI: -2.6 to -0.6; I2: 49%), and the mean resting LVEF for CCS was in the normal range in all studies (Range: 61.4% to 72.0%). Conclusion Despite negligible differences in resting cardiac function, CCS have a marked reduction in VO2peak that may explain their increased risk of heart failure and cardiovascular mortality. Incorporating measures of VO2peak into cardiac surveillance may improve the identification of CCS at risk of future cardiovascular events who may benefit from therapies (eg. exercise-based cardiac rehabilitation) to address impairment in VO2peak.
